Perrysville Happenings |
|||||||
Richland Shield & Banner - Mansfield, Richland, Ohio: 02 April 1887 |

Perrysville. Lillie Nina, the three-years-old daughter of Mr. & Mrs. L.E. Darling, was buried last Friday at St. John’s. She was a great favorite and the bereaved parents have the sympathy of the entire community. [Richland Shield & Banner (Mansfield, Richland, Ohio): 02 April 1887, Vol. LXIX, No. 36]
Perrysville. Less than two weeks ago, Mrs. Wooden, the mother of Mrs. Prof. Ford, died at Akron. After her burial, Mr. Wooden, who was an invalid, was brought to the home of Prof. Ford; he only lived a few days and last Wednesday his remains were taken to Akron for burial. [Richland Shield & Banner (Mansfield, Richland, Ohio): 02 April 1887, Vol. LXIX, No. 36]
